Ok this my response to 343s assertion that h5 will by able to toggle off sprint. It won’t work. It can’t work as a toggle off because the problem lies in the excessively large maps you produce to go with it. The large maps increase the distances between opponents at initial contact, thus minimizing the use of grenades, melee and automatic weapons because of there inherent accuracy issues at those ranges. So the br and dmr dominate at common ranges. This works ok for Btb and TS but not for FFA or Obj game types. How about a compromise. Design h5 MM (because it doesn’t really matter in campaign) as a toggle On Sprint. Meaning maps and gameplay is designed for non Sprint games like FFA and objectives, but Sprint can be toggled on for TS or BTB in desired playlists. 1 other possible option if you can’t get past a toggle off sprint, is to set it up so the toggle off sprint, toggles on 125 percent bps to help us close the gap without being disarmed.
